i think it will be a fun project. F100's shared axles with the early bronco's correct? if not some one fill me in on thease axles....
 
No. Early broncos are low pinion and are the correct width for a Ranger. A F-100 is a fullsize truck, therefore it has fullsize axles, meaning they are going to be pretty wide under your Ranger.
 
yeah thats the idea, make it a full width,the guy said the f100 has a HP d44 which is what im looking for anyway, and at his price for the set its hard to beat!

and i guess i was refering to like 79+ as early i dont know if 78 broncos were full width. so its like late 60s mid 70s as the narrow width axles right?
